In-House vs Outsourced NetSuite Support: Pros and Cons

In-House vs Outsourced NetSuite Support: Pros and Cons

The short answer

In-house NetSuite support offers direct control and internal knowledge, while outsourced support provides broader expertise, scalability, and often better long-term efficiency.

The right choice depends on your business complexity, internal resources, and how critical NetSuite is to your operations.

Quick comparison: In-house vs outsourced NetSuite support

  • In-house: Full control and internal familiarity
  • Outsourced: Access to broader expertise and experience
  • In-house: Limited by individual skillsets
  • Outsourced: Team-based support model
  • In-house: Fixed internal cost
  • Outsourced: Scalable based on needs

What is in-house NetSuite support?

In-house support means your organization manages NetSuite internally, typically through one or more dedicated employees.

This model often includes:

  • Internal administrators or developers
  • Direct access to system knowledge
  • Immediate availability for internal requests

What is outsourced NetSuite support?

Outsourced support involves working with an external partner that provides ongoing NetSuite support and expertise.

This model typically includes:

  • A team of specialists
  • Access to broader experience
  • Ongoing system optimization

Pros and cons of in-house NetSuite support

Pros of in-house support

  • Deep familiarity with your business
  • Direct control over priorities
  • Immediate access to resources

Cons of in-house support

  • Limited expertise across all NetSuite functions
  • Reliance on one or a few individuals
  • Difficulty scaling as needs grow
  • Higher risk if key employees leave

Pros and cons of outsourced NetSuite support

Pros of outsourced support

  • Access to a team with diverse expertise
  • Scalable support based on your needs
  • Exposure to best practices across industries
  • Proactive system improvements

Cons of outsourced support

  • Less day-to-day internal visibility
  • Requires strong communication
  • May involve higher upfront investment depending on the model

When in-house NetSuite support makes sense

  • Your system is relatively simple
  • You have experienced internal resources
  • Your support needs are limited

When outsourced NetSuite support makes sense

  • Your environment is complex
  • You need access to broader expertise
  • You want proactive system improvement
  • You are scaling your business

The hybrid approach: Best of both worlds

Many companies find success with a hybrid model:

  • Internal team for day-to-day operations
  • External partner for advanced support and optimization

This approach combines internal knowledge with external expertise.

How this connects to overall NetSuite support strategy

Choosing between in-house and outsourced support is part of a broader support strategy.

👉 Learn what high-quality NetSuite support services include
👉 Understand what NetSuite support actually covers
👉 See how NetSuite support is structured and priced

Common mistakes companies make

Relying too heavily on one internal resource

This creates risk and limits scalability.

Underestimating the need for specialized expertise

NetSuite often requires skills that go beyond a single individual.

Choosing based only on cost

The lowest-cost option is not always the most effective long-term solution.

Final thoughts

There is no one-size-fits-all answer when it comes to NetSuite support.

The right model depends on your business needs, system complexity, and long-term goals.

Evaluating your NetSuite support model?

If you’re deciding between in-house and outsourced support, it helps to work with a team that understands how to balance efficiency, expertise, and long-term value.

At The Vested Group, we help companies design support models that align with their business and growth strategy.

👉 Learn more about how we support NetSuite environments
👉 See real client success stories

Share
Comments (0)

Subscribe to The Vested Group Blog Email Updates